Metallized Carbon Corporation has been supplying Industrial customers worldwide with Engineered Carbon/Graphite Solutions for Severe Service Lubrication since 1945. With corporate headquarters located in New York and manufacturing facilities strategically situated to serve the global market, Metallized Carbon manufactures the Metcar family of Solid, Self-Lubricating, Oil Free materials.

Metallized Carbon Corporation Company Profile
Metallized Carbon Corporation is located in Ossining, NY, United States and is part of the Electrical Products Manufacturing Industry. Metallized Carbon Corporation has 140 total employees across all of its locations and generates $32.60 million in sales (USD).

Resin Impregnated, Carbon
Metallized Carbon Corporation The machineable blanks are made from fine-grained, high strength, molded carbon-graphite that is fully impregnated with chemically resistant, thermal setting resin. The material has excellent lubricating qualities when running in low viscosity liquids in the temperature range between -400˚F and over 500˚F.
